fre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

全國計算機二級公共基礎(chǔ)知識復習-免費閱讀

2025-05-10 22:12 上一頁面

下一頁面
  

【正文】 其中表示實體聯(lián)系的是_________框。在關(guān)系元組的分量中允許出現(xiàn)空值(Null Value)以表示信息空缺。 在關(guān)系模型中的一個重要概念是鍵(Key)或碼。 滿足下面7個性質(zhì)的二維表稱為關(guān)系(Relation): 1) 元組個數(shù)有限性:二維表中元組個數(shù)是有限的。每個屬性有一個取值范圍,稱為值域(Domain)。下圖表示student與course間有多對多聯(lián)系: 兩個實體集間聯(lián)系叫二元聯(lián)系,多個實體集間聯(lián)系叫多元聯(lián)系。在ER圖中我們分別用下面不同的幾何圖形表示ER模型中的三個概念與兩個聯(lián)接關(guān)系。在概念世界中聯(lián)系反映了實體集間的一定關(guān)系。實體:現(xiàn)實世界中的事物可以抽象成為實體。數(shù)據(jù)操縱語言(DML):負責數(shù)據(jù)的操縱,包括查詢及增、刪、改等操作。答案:程序4. 對軟件設(shè)計的最小單位(模塊或程序單元)進行的測試通常為_______測試。習題:(一)選擇題(單選)1. 軟件按功能可以分為:應(yīng)用軟件、系統(tǒng)軟件和支撐軟件(或工具軟件)。所以,黑盒測試是在軟件接口處進行,完成功能驗證。它是根據(jù)軟件產(chǎn)品的內(nèi)部工作過程,檢查內(nèi)部成分,以確認每種內(nèi)部操作符合設(shè)計規(guī)格要求。軟件測試的目的:是發(fā)現(xiàn)錯誤。原則上講,模塊化設(shè)計總是希望模塊間的耦合表現(xiàn)為非直接耦合方式。衡量軟件的模塊獨立性使用耦合性和內(nèi)聚性兩個定性的度量標準。判定樹判定表結(jié)構(gòu)化設(shè)計方法常見的過程設(shè)計工具:圖形工具:程序流程圖,NS圖,PAD圖(問題分析圖),HIPO表格工具:判定表。軟件由兩部分組成:一是機器可執(zhí)行的程序和數(shù)據(jù);二是機器不可執(zhí)行的,與軟件開發(fā)、運行、維護、使用等有關(guān)的文檔。習題:(一)選擇題(單選)1. 下列敘述中正確的是( D )A)棧是“先進先出”的線性表B)隊列是“先進后出”的線性表C)循環(huán)隊列是非線性結(jié)構(gòu)D)有序線性表既可以采用順序存儲結(jié)構(gòu),也可以采用鏈式存儲結(jié)構(gòu)2. 下列關(guān)于棧的敘述中正確的是( A )A) 棧頂元素最先被刪除 B) 棧頂元素最后才能被刪除C) 棧底元素永遠不能被刪除 D) 以上三種說法都不對3. 下列敘述中正確的是( B )A) 有一個以上根結(jié)點的數(shù)據(jù)結(jié)構(gòu)不一定是非線性結(jié)構(gòu)B) 只有一個根結(jié)點的數(shù)據(jù)結(jié)構(gòu)不一定是線性結(jié)構(gòu)C) 循環(huán)鏈表是非線性結(jié)構(gòu)D) 雙向鏈表是非線性結(jié)構(gòu)4. 支持子程序調(diào)用的數(shù)據(jù)結(jié)構(gòu)是( A )A) 棧 B) 樹 C) 隊列 D) 二叉樹5. 某二叉樹有5個度為2的結(jié)點,則該二叉樹中的葉子結(jié)點數(shù)是( C )A)10 B)8 C)6 D)4提示:在任意二叉樹中,若度為0的結(jié)點(即葉子結(jié)點)的個數(shù)為n0,度為2的結(jié)點的個數(shù)為n2,則:n0= n2+1 即 n0(葉子結(jié)點數(shù))=5+1=66. 某二叉樹共有7個結(jié)點,其中葉子結(jié)點只有1個,則該二叉樹的深度為(假設(shè)根結(jié)點在第一層)( D )A) 3 B) 4 C) 6 D)77. 下列排序方法中,最壞情況下比較次數(shù)最少的是( D )A)冒泡排序 B)簡單選擇排序 C)直接插入排序 D)堆排序8. 下列敘述中正確的是( A )A) 對長度為n的有序鏈表進行查找,最壞的情況下需要的比較次數(shù)為nB) 對長度為n的有序鏈表進行對分查找,最壞的情況下需要的比較次數(shù)為(n/2)C) 對長度為n的有序鏈表進行對分查找,最壞的情況下需要的比較次數(shù)為(log2n)D) 對長度為n的有序鏈表進行對分查找,最壞的情況下需要的比較次數(shù)為(nlog2n)(二) 填空題1. 假設(shè)用一個長度為50的數(shù)組(數(shù)組元素的下標從0到49)作為棧的存儲空間,棧底指針bottom指向棧底元素,棧頂指針top指向棧頂元素,如果bottom=49,top=30(數(shù)組下標),則棧中具有________個元素。算法的時間復雜度為O(n2)。通過對線性表的一次分割,就以T為分界線,將線性表分成了前后兩個子表,且前面子表中的所有元素均不大于T,后面子表中的所有元素均不小于T。在本節(jié)所介紹的排序方法中,其排序的對象一般認為是順序存儲的線性表,在程序設(shè)計語言中就是一維數(shù)組。通常是指有序表中的元素按值升序排列(非遞減有序排列)。對于無序表(即表中的元素的排列是無序的)和鏈式存儲結(jié)構(gòu)的線性表(有序的和無序的),只能用順序查找。查找是指在一個給定的數(shù)據(jù)結(jié)構(gòu)中查找某個指定的元素。在遍歷左、右子樹時,仍然先遍歷其左子樹,然后訪問子樹的根結(jié)點,最后遍歷其右子樹。③ 遍歷右子樹(假設(shè)用R表示)。2) 如果2in,則結(jié)點i無左子結(jié)點,顯然也沒有右子結(jié)點,是葉子結(jié)點。在完全二叉樹中,若某個結(jié)點沒有左子結(jié)點,則它一定沒有右子結(jié)點,即該結(jié)點必是葉子結(jié)點。② 二叉樹中的每個結(jié)點,最多有兩棵子樹,分另稱為該結(jié)點的左子樹與右子樹。在樹形結(jié)構(gòu)中一般按如下原則分層:1) 根結(jié)點在第1層。結(jié)點的度:在樹形結(jié)構(gòu)中,一個結(jié)點所擁有的后繼個數(shù)稱為該結(jié)點的度。參見下面的圖形:樹形結(jié)構(gòu)的基本特征及基本術(shù)語:以下圖為例:樹的根:在樹形結(jié)構(gòu)中,沒有前驅(qū)的結(jié)點只有一個,稱為樹的根結(jié)點,簡稱為樹的根。隊列是指只允許在表的一端插入元素、在另一端刪除元素的線性表。棧和隊列本質(zhì)上也是線性表,只是它們的操作受到了限制。ai(i=1,2, …,n):為表的元素,也稱為線性表中的一個結(jié)點。注:某個元素直接相鄰的前一個元素稱為此元素的前驅(qū)、直接相鄰的后一個元素稱為此元素的后繼。也就是將所有存儲結(jié)點相繼存入在一個連續(xù)相鄰的存儲區(qū)里?!?算法的空間復雜度:算法的空間復雜度一般是指執(zhí)行這個算法所需要的內(nèi)存空間。邏輯上的數(shù)據(jù)結(jié)構(gòu)反映數(shù)據(jù)之間的邏輯關(guān)系,而物理上的數(shù)據(jù)結(jié)構(gòu)反映數(shù)據(jù)在計算機內(nèi)部的存儲安排。數(shù)據(jù)結(jié)構(gòu)是數(shù)據(jù)存在的形式?!魯?shù)據(jù)的邏輯結(jié)構(gòu)數(shù)據(jù)元素相互之間的關(guān)系,稱為結(jié)構(gòu)。數(shù)據(jù)的鏈式存儲方式:是在存儲每個結(jié)點信息的同時,增加一個指針來表示結(jié)點間的邏輯關(guān)系。非線性結(jié)構(gòu)的邏輯特征:在一個非空的數(shù)據(jù)結(jié)構(gòu)中,某數(shù)據(jù)元素可能有多于一個前驅(qū)或后繼。它可以是一個數(shù)、一個字符、一個字符串,也可以是一條記錄,還可以是復雜的數(shù)據(jù)對象。棧是限定僅在表尾進行插入和刪除操作的線性表。允許插入的一端稱為隊尾(rear),允許刪除的一端稱為隊頭(front)。如:上圖中的“R”。如:上圖中根結(jié)點R的度是4;結(jié)點T的度是3;結(jié)點P、Q、D、O、Y、W的度都為1。2) 其余結(jié)點的層數(shù)等于其父結(jié)點的層數(shù)加1。當一個結(jié)點即沒有左子樹也沒有右子樹時,該結(jié)點就是葉子結(jié)點。(3) 二叉樹的性質(zhì)假設(shè)定義根結(jié)點的層數(shù)為1(注意:有些資料中規(guī)定根結(jié)點的層數(shù)為0)。如果2i≤n,則結(jié)點i的左子結(jié)點是編號為2i的結(jié)點。在遍歷二叉樹的過程中,一般先遍歷左子樹,然后再遍歷右子樹。即,中序遍歷是指訪問所有的根結(jié)點(包括子樹的根結(jié)點)都在遍歷其左子樹之后、在遍歷其右子樹之前。通常,根據(jù)不同的數(shù)據(jù)結(jié)構(gòu),應(yīng)采用不同的查找方法。順序查找的優(yōu)點:算法簡單而適用范圍廣。二分查找不能用于鏈式存儲結(jié)構(gòu)的線性表。 這里的排序算法,都是針對升序排序。 如果對分割后的各子表再按上述原則進行分割,并且這種分割過程可以一直做下去,隨著對各子表不斷地進行分割,劃分出的子表會越來越多(一次只能對一個子表進行再分割處理),直到所有子表中的元素都排好序為止,則此時的線性表就變成了有序表。(2) 希爾排序 希爾排序的基本思想:請查看相關(guān)資料。 答案:202. 一個隊列的初始狀態(tài)為空。軟件的分類 軟件按功能可以分為:應(yīng)用軟件、系統(tǒng)軟件、支撐軟件(或工具軟件)。語言工具:PDL(偽碼)軟件設(shè)計的基本原理 1) 抽象:是一種思維
點擊復制文檔內(nèi)容
教學教案相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1